pub fn codes(rs: &[RangeInclusive<usize>]) -> Vec<Code>Expand description
Provides Codes for ranges specified.
Input values must fit into range 0-127, otherwise function will panic.
Duplicities and input order are preserved.
use huski_lib_core::ranges::LETTERS;
use huski_lib::codes;
let cs = codes(&LETTERS);
assert_eq!(52, cs.len());
assert_eq!('A', cs[0].code() as char);
assert_eq!('z', cs[51].code() as char);